#d57ca4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d57ca4 is composed of 83.5% red, 48.6%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.8% magenta, 23%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 333 degrees, a saturation of 51.4% and a lightness of 66.1%. #d57ca4 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ff8ff with #ab0049.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

Shades and Tints of #d57ca4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030102 is the darkest color, while #fbf3f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d57ca4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#ada4a8 is the less saturated color, while #fd54a0 is the most saturated one.
